VPD arrests suspect in two sexual assaults

A joint VPD and Metro Vancouver Transit Police investigation has led to the arrest of Bryce Michael Flores-Bebington for two alleged sexual assaults.

At 7:30 p.m. on July 6, a 24-year-old woman reported she had been sexually assaulted while on the escalator at the Granville SkyTrain Station by a suspect who ran away. The investigation was completed by Metro Vancouver Transit Police.

A second incident occurred the following day on West Broadway at Ash Street. Just before 2 p.m. a 38-year-old woman was sexually assaulted.

Bryce Michael Flores-Bebington, 19, has been charged with two counts of sexual assault and was arrested this morning by the VPD. He remains in custody and is scheduled to appear in court today.
